JDOC

Difference between revisions of "Joomla! 1.5 Template Tutorials Project/Outline"

From Joomla! Documentation

< JDOC:Joomla! 1.5 Template Tutorials Project
m (Adjusted link after page move)
(5 intermediate revisions by 2 users not shown)
Line 6: Line 6:
 
* [[Templates supplied with Joomla!|Templates supplied with Joomla!]]
 
* [[Templates supplied with Joomla!|Templates supplied with Joomla!]]
 
* [[How to switch templates|How to switch templates]]
 
* [[How to switch templates|How to switch templates]]
* [[How to install templates|How to install templates]]
+
* [[Installing a template|How to install templates]]
  
 
= Understanding Joomla! templates =
 
= Understanding Joomla! templates =
Line 24: Line 24:
 
= Customising the default Joomla! templates =
 
= Customising the default Joomla! templates =
 
* [[Pros and cons of table layout]]
 
* [[Pros and cons of table layout]]
* [[Understanding the Milkyway template]]
+
* [[Understanding the Milky Way template]]
 
* [[Understanding the Beez template]]
 
* [[Understanding the Beez template]]
 
* [[Understanding the JA_Purity template]]
 
* [[Understanding the JA_Purity template]]
* [[Customising the Milkyway template]]
+
* [[Customising the Milky Way template]]
 
* [[Customising the Beez template]]
 
* [[Customising the Beez template]]
 
* [[Customising the JA_Purity template]]
 
* [[Customising the JA_Purity template]]
Line 106: Line 106:
 
= Template translations =
 
= Template translations =
 
* [[Introduction to template translation]]
 
* [[Introduction to template translation]]
* [[Location of language definition files]]
+
* [[Location of template language definition files]]
 
* [[Creating a language definition file]]
 
* [[Creating a language definition file]]
 
* [[Amending the templateDetails.xml file]]
 
* [[Amending the templateDetails.xml file]]
 
* [[Embedding translatable strings in the template]]
 
* [[Embedding translatable strings in the template]]
 +
* [[Formatted fields in language translation strings]]
 
* [[Debugging a translation]]
 
* [[Debugging a translation]]
 
 
* [[Adding a language file to the templateDetails.xml file]]
 
  
 
= Distributing Joomla! templates =
 
= Distributing Joomla! templates =

Revision as of 19:02, 29 January 2011

Suggested outline for the new template tutorials. This suggests a breakdown into numerous smaller tutorials.

Introduction to Joomla! templates[edit]

Understanding Joomla! templates[edit]

Upgrading a Joomla! 1.0.x template[edit]

Customising the default Joomla! templates[edit]

Creating a basic Joomla! template[edit]

More advanced Joomla! templates[edit]

Cascading Style Sheets (CSS)[edit]

More on Joomla! modules[edit]

Web Standards[edit]

Web content accessibility[edit]

Template parameters[edit]

Fonts and typography[edit]

Template overrides[edit]

Template translations[edit]

Distributing Joomla! templates[edit]

Advanced topics[edit]

Appendix[edit]